The ST203C107MAJ05 is a 100µF, 25V rated, X7R dielectric ceramic capacitor from Kyocera AVX's TurboCap series. It features a stacked SMD construction with J-Lead terminations, designed for surface mount assembly. The X7R temperature coefficient provides a capacitance change of ±15% over the -55°C to +125°C operating temperature range.
This capacitor offers ultra-low ESR values: 0.003Ω typical at 10KHz, 0.0015Ω at 50KHz, and 0.001Ω at 100KHz. Maximum dissipation factor is 2.5% at 25°C and 1KHz. Minimum insulation resistance is 500 MΩ-µF at 25°C and 50 MΩ-µF at 125°C. Dielectric withstanding voltage is 250% of rated voltage for 5 seconds.
The part is housed in a Stacked SMD, 10 J-Lead package measuring 13.34mm x 7.62mm with a maximum thickness of 5.59mm. It is intended for SMPS filtering, bypass, and decoupling applications where low ESL is critical.
